Your diesel stove may not be burning properly due to several reasons, such as clogged fuel lines or filters, which restrict fuel flow. Insufficient air supply or improper ventilation can also lead to incomplete combustion. Additionally, using low-quality diesel or contaminated fuel can affect performance. Regular maintenance and cleaning are essential to ensure optimal operation.

How do you seal a flue pipe onto a wood burning stove?

If the correct fittings are used and properly installed,no sealing should be necessary. ----- Sometimes there is a small gap, and if this is a problem, it can be filled with stove cement.

What can you do to stop smell coming from oil burning stove?

To reduce the smell from an oil-burning stove, first ensure that the stove is properly maintained and cleaned regularly to prevent buildup and residue. Use high-quality fuel to minimize smoke and odor. Additionally, ensure proper ventilation in the area by opening windows or using exhaust fans. If the smell persists, consider consulting a professional to check for any underlying issues with the stove.


Can you leave the door open to burn wood in your earth stove?

Leaving the door open while burning wood in your earth stove is not recommended as it can lead to inefficient burning, increased emissions, and potential safety hazards. It's best to keep the door closed to control the airflow and ensure the wood burns properly.

Can you use hazelnut wood to burn in stove?

Yes, hazelnut wood can be used for burning in a stove. It produces a good amount of heat and has a pleasant aroma when burned. However, ensure that the wood is properly seasoned to minimize smoke and maximize efficiency. Always check local regulations or guidelines for burning different types of wood.
